projects
/
ulas
/
.git
/ shortlog
commit
grep
author
committer
pickaxe
?
search:
re
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
ulas/.git
2023-12-04
Lukas Krickl
Added $ for current address
commit
|
commitdiff
|
tree
|
snapshot
2023-12-04
Lukas Krickl
Added local scope resolver test
commit
|
commitdiff
|
tree
|
snapshot
2023-12-03
Lukas Krickl
Added '@' check to islabelname
commit
|
commitdiff
|
tree
|
snapshot
2023-12-03
Lukas Krickl
Added test for setting
commit
|
commitdiff
|
tree
|
snapshot
2023-12-03
Lukas Krickl
WIP: re-assigning symbols
commit
|
commitdiff
|
tree
|
snapshot
2023-12-03
Lukas Krickl
Added test for scoped redefinition
commit
|
commitdiff
|
tree
|
snapshot
2023-12-03
Lukas Krickl
WIP: moved : removal code to symbolset
commit
|
commitdiff
|
tree
|
snapshot
2023-12-03
Lukas Krickl
Fixed scope tests
commit
|
commitdiff
|
tree
|
snapshot
2023-12-03
Lukas Krickl
WIP: symbol scoping tests
commit
|
commitdiff
|
tree
|
snapshot
2023-12-02
Lukas Krickl
Added proper label resolver for globals with test
commit
|
commitdiff
|
tree
|
snapshot
2023-12-02
Lukas Krickl
WIP: address labels
commit
|
commitdiff
|
tree
|
snapshot
2023-12-02
Lukas Krickl
WIP: symbol definition
commit
|
commitdiff
|
tree
|
snapshot
2023-12-02
Lukas Krickl
WIP: symbol def
commit
|
commitdiff
|
tree
|
snapshot
2023-12-02
Lukas Krickl
WIP: symbol definition
commit
|
commitdiff
|
tree
|
snapshot
2023-12-02
Lukas Krickl
WIP: added const flag to symbols
commit
|
commitdiff
|
tree
|
snapshot
2023-11-30
Lukas Krickl
WIP: symbols
commit
|
commitdiff
|
tree
|
snapshot
2023-11-30
Lukas Krickl
WIP: symbol defines
commit
|
commitdiff
|
tree
|
snapshot
2023-11-30
Lukas Krickl
Moved label code to asmline
commit
|
commitdiff
|
tree
|
snapshot
2023-11-30
Lukas Krickl
WIP: label parser
commit
|
commitdiff
|
tree
|
snapshot
2023-11-30
Lukas Krickl
WIP: symbols
commit
|
commitdiff
|
tree
|
snapshot
2023-11-30
Lukas Krickl
Added headers to dependencies for obejct files
commit
|
commitdiff
|
tree
|
snapshot
2023-11-29
Lukas Krickl
Added benchmark output
commit
|
commitdiff
|
tree
|
snapshot
2023-11-29
Lukas Krickl
Moved preprocessor definition to ulas struct
commit
|
commitdiff
|
tree
|
snapshot
2023-11-29
Lukas Krickl
Added doc for 2-pass mode
commit
|
commitdiff
|
tree
|
snapshot
2023-11-29
Lukas Krickl
Fixed line numbering in 2-pass mode
commit
|
commitdiff
|
tree
|
snapshot
2023-11-29
Lukas Krickl
Added 2-pass code when stdin is not stin
commit
|
commitdiff
|
tree
|
snapshot
2023-11-29
Lukas Krickl
Removed pass code
commit
|
commitdiff
|
tree
|
snapshot
2023-11-29
Lukas Krickl
Removed multi pass system again for now
commit
|
commitdiff
|
tree
|
snapshot
2023-11-29
Lukas Krickl
WIP: multi-pass setup
commit
|
commitdiff
|
tree
|
snapshot
2023-11-28
Lukas Krickl
WIP: symbols
commit
|
commitdiff
|
tree
|
snapshot
2023-11-28
Lukas Krickl
WIP: multi-pass
commit
|
commitdiff
|
tree
|
snapshot
2023-11-28
Lukas Krickl
WIP: label scoping
commit
|
commitdiff
|
tree
|
snapshot
2023-11-28
Lukas Krickl
WIP: multi-pass symbol resolver
commit
|
commitdiff
|
tree
|
snapshot
2023-11-27
Lukas Krickl
WIP: Fixed linter warnings
commit
|
commitdiff
|
tree
|
snapshot
2023-11-27
Lukas Krickl
WIP: symbol buffer
commit
|
commitdiff
|
tree
|
snapshot
2023-11-27
Lukas Krickl
Fixed rc check fo symbol resolver
commit
|
commitdiff
|
tree
|
snapshot
2023-11-27
Lukas Krickl
WIP: symbol resolver
commit
|
commitdiff
|
tree
|
snapshot
2023-11-27
Lukas Krickl
WIP: symbol resolver
commit
|
commitdiff
|
tree
|
snapshot
2023-11-26
Lukas Krickl
Added built tests for t0
commit
|
commitdiff
|
tree
|
snapshot
2023-11-26
Lukas Krickl
WIP: full integration test
commit
|
commitdiff
|
tree
|
snapshot
2023-11-26
Lukas Krickl
Added asm instruction tests
commit
|
commitdiff
|
tree
|
snapshot
2023-11-26
Lukas Krickl
Fixed tests
commit
|
commitdiff
|
tree
|
snapshot
2023-11-26
Lukas Krickl
Move test
commit
|
commitdiff
|
tree
|
snapshot
2023-11-26
Lukas Krickl
WIP: tests
commit
|
commitdiff
|
tree
|
snapshot
2023-11-26
Lukas Krickl
Added all inst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-26
Lukas Krickl
Fixed bit inst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-26
Lukas Krickl
WIP: prefixed inst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-25
Lukas Krickl
Added remainder of non-prefixed inst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-25
Lukas Krickl
Added rst inst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-24
Lukas Krickl
Added push and calls
commit
|
commitdiff
|
tree
|
snapshot
2023-11-24
Lukas Krickl
Added pop and jp
commit
|
commitdiff
|
tree
|
snapshot
2023-11-24
Lukas Krickl
Added more ld inst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-24
Lukas Krickl
More inst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-24
Lukas Krickl
WIP: more inst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-24
Lukas Krickl
Added more inst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-24
Lukas Krickl
Implemented more inst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-24
Lukas Krickl
WIP: Added some inst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-23
Lukas Krickl
Added instructions that can contain expressions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-22
Lukas Krickl
WIP: parser
commit
|
commitdiff
|
tree
|
snapshot
2023-11-22
Lukas Krickl
WIP: better instruction parser
commit
|
commitdiff
|
tree
|
snapshot
2023-11-22
Lukas Krickl
WIP: lut based inst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-22
Lukas Krickl
WIP: universal instruction parser table
commit
|
commitdiff
|
tree
|
snapshot
2023-11-22
Lukas Krickl
added first working ld instruction
commit
|
commitdiff
|
tree
|
snapshot
2023-11-22
Lukas Krickl
WIP: error handling
commit
|
commitdiff
|
tree
|
snapshot
2023-11-22
Lukas Krickl
WIP: ld instruction
commit
|
commitdiff
|
tree
|
snapshot
2023-11-22
Lukas Krickl
WIP: asm load instruction
commit
|
commitdiff
|
tree
|
snapshot
2023-11-21
Lukas Krickl
WIP: ld8
commit
|
commitdiff
|
tree
|
snapshot
2023-11-21
Lukas Krickl
WIP: ld inst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-21
Lukas Krickl
WIP: ld inst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-21
Lukas Krickl
WIP: Added register definitions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-21
Lukas Krickl
Fixed listing output
commit
|
commitdiff
|
tree
|
snapshot
2023-11-21
Lukas Krickl
Added docs
commit
|
commitdiff
|
tree
|
snapshot
2023-11-21
Lukas Krickl
Changed totok to also use istokterm
commit
|
commitdiff
|
tree
|
snapshot
2023-11-21
Lukas Krickl
Moved comment handling to single point
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Moved comment check to empty line check
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Added comment support to instruction parser
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
WIP: first instructions are being parsed
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
WIP: asm step tokenizer
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Moved output to separate functions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Made '-' a constant
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Fixed files
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Listing output is now using the correct file
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
WIP: added FILE* for symbol and listing buffer
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
WIP: instructions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
WIP: instruction parsing
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
WIP: Added org directive
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Added group expressions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Implemented unary expressions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Fixed some warnings
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Added more operators
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Added symbol to list of valid primary expressions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Added equality expression
commit
|
commitdiff
|
tree
|
snapshot
2023-11-20
Lukas Krickl
Added literal expressions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-19
Lukas Krickl
WIP: expression eval
commit
|
commitdiff
|
tree
|
snapshot
2023-11-19
Lukas Krickl
WIP: parser for int expressions
commit
|
commitdiff
|
tree
|
snapshot
2023-11-19
Lukas Krickl
WIP: parser
commit
|
commitdiff
|
tree
|
snapshot
2023-11-19
Lukas Krickl
Added expression buffer
commit
|
commitdiff
|
tree
|
snapshot
2023-11-19
Lukas Krickl
WIP: tokenizer
commit
|
commitdiff
|
tree
|
snapshot
2023-11-19
Lukas Krickl
WIP: tokenizer adding special tokens
commit
|
commitdiff
|
tree
|
snapshot
2023-11-19
Lukas Krickl
WIP: int expressions
commit
|
commitdiff
|
tree
|
snapshot
next